# Basement Archive Room — Night Access

The archive room under Pellworth House holds old contracts and the tape backups. Night shift: take stairwell C, not the lift (it's switched off after midnight). Lights are on a timer by the door — slap the button as you go in. Sign the logbook, even at 3am, yes really. The keypad by the door takes the code below.

staff pass of fahap-tajeg = bdg-FT-6

**Runbook: Scrubwell account recovery**

Context for the sync: the Scrubwell EXIF-scrubbing service lost its admin account after last week's IAM cleanup. Recovery steps: 1) Verify the scrub workers are still processing (they run on cached tokens, ~72h). 2) Boot the recovery console from the warm standby in Felmarsh. 3) Re-issue the admin credential before tokens expire. Step 3 prompts for the service recovery passphrase. Do not regenerate it — that orphans the cache. Use the existing one, shown below.

unlock words, yawig-kagef: gordor-holvan-ulaael-pramir-ulaiel-tamdor

Ticket #2093 — Report builder: signature check keeps failing after sort changes

Heads up for support: the Larkspur report builder started failing signature verification after we "fixed" sorting. Turns out the old sort wasn't stable, so identical timestamps shuffled between runs and the signed manifest hash never matched. The new stable sort in 3.8.2 fixes it, but every cached report needs re-signing. When walking customers through the re-sign tool, have them paste in the key shown here:

release key, fahaf-bajof: bky3_Xam

### RestockPilot: Release Prerequisites

Before cutting a release, confirm that the RestockPilot planner can reach the SnackGrid inventory service, since the build pipeline runs an integration smoke test against staging during packaging. A failed handshake here blocks the release tag, so verify credentials first. The pipeline reads its staging credential from the deploy config; for reference and manual verification, the current key appears below.

service key, tajof-fawip: vxb4-JNOz

**Ticket TMS-armature: solver drops Friday afternoon blocks**

Chalkplan's timetable solver silently discards any lesson slot after 14:00 on Fridays when room capacity constraints are tight. Root cause looks like an off-by-one in the availability mask. Fix must include a regression case for the Northgale Academy dataset. Reproduced consistently on the build whose token follows.

trace token, fafog-kageg: htk4_98e6